Oregon – Scam Alert: Fake Sheriff Calls; Deputies Say “We’ll Never Ask for Bitcoin...
Salem, OR – Marion County residents are being warned about a phone scam involving callers impersonating Sheriff’s Deputies and demanding payment for fake fines or missed jury duty. The Marion County Sheriff’s Office (MCSO) issued an alert Wednesday urging the public to be cautious and to recognize the warning signs.

Frost Advisory issued for parts of the Willamette Valley Wednesday
PORTLAND, Ore. (KOIN) — Chilly fall weather returns early Wednesday morning for much of the Willamette Valley. Much of the Portland-Vancouver metro area will steer clear of frosty morning conditions, but a few low lying areas along the Willamette Valley have the potential to see temperatures fall to nearly freezing.
Marion County Property Tax Statements Arriving Soon; Assessor Reports 5.58% Growth in Real Market...
Marion County certified its 2025-26 tax roll showing a 5.58% overall property value increase to $76.68 billion; homeowners will see varied rate changes countywide. Watchlist: ‘Indigenous Peoples Day celebrated at Salem’s Riverfront Park’
Indigenous Peoples Day was first recognized in Oregon in 2021 as the second Monday of October, making this year’s Indigenous Peoples Day Monday, Oct. 13.
